mysql怎么修改表的数据类型 修改mysql中表的属性

导读:
在使用MySQL数据库时,我们经常需要修改表的属性以满足不同的需求 。这篇文章将介绍如何修改MySQL中表的属性 , 包括添加、删除、修改列和索引等操作 。
1. 添加列
如果需要向已有的表中添加一个新的列,可以使用ALTER TABLE语句来实现 。例如,要向名为“students”的表中添加一个名为“age”的列 , 类型为INT,可以执行以下命令:
ALTER TABLE students ADD age INT;
2. 删除列
如果需要从已有的表中删除一个列,可以使用ALTER TABLE语句来实现 。例如,要从名为“students”的表中删除名为“age”的列 , 可以执行以下命令:
ALTER TABLE students DROP COLUMN age;
3. 修改列
如果需要修改已有列的属性 , 可以使用ALTER TABLE语句来实现 。例如,要将名为“students”的表中名为“age”的列的类型从INT改为VARCHAR(10),可以执行以下命令:
ALTER TABLE students MODIFY age VARCHAR(10);
4. 添加索引
如果需要添加索引以提高查询效率 , 可以使用ALTER TABLE语句来实现 。例如,要向名为“students”的表中添加一个名为“name_index”的索引,可以执行以下命令:
ALTER TABLE students ADD INDEX name_index (name);
5. 删除索引
如果需要删除已有的索引,可以使用ALTER TABLE语句来实现 。例如 , 要从名为“students”的表中删除名为“name_index”的索引,可以执行以下命令:
ALTER TABLE students DROP INDEX name_index;
总结:
【mysql怎么修改表的数据类型 修改mysql中表的属性】在MySQL中,修改表的属性是一项非常重要的操作 。通过添加、删除、修改列和索引等操作 , 我们可以根据不同的需求来优化数据库的设计和性能 。熟练掌握这些技巧,将有助于提高开发效率和数据查询速度 。

    推荐阅读